    A new story arc begins with fan favorite Chris Bachalo returning to the pages of the X-Men! Wolverine, Cyclops and Fantomex travel from one side of the globe to the other and beyond in search of answers to Wolverine's mysterious past! What will they find? And who or what is "The World"?

    Spinning out of last arc story "Murder at the mansion" Morrison explores a brooding and inconsolable Scott Summers hiding out in the Hellfire Club, trying to forget his sorrows, fears and doubts in the bottom of a glass of sparkling wine? Thanks to all of the X genes Logan shows up to man up his buddie and teach him how to drink the mighty whiskey!! This is definitely one of the best issues ever of X-Men, because it's about two arch rivals sitting down and drinking, with excellent dialogues and ...
